S.C. Code Ann. § 12-28-2350: Inspection of records pertaining to petroleum products.

The department may inspect all records of a person doing business in this State for the purpose of ascertaining information relative to the sales, transportation, or possession of petroleum products. Legible records must be kept at the point of origin or reasonable approved proximity for auditing purposes. Terminal operators and suppliers as defined in Section 12-28-110 may maintain records at an approved central recordkeeping facility within or outside the State.
